How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Golden Hills?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Golden Hills Studio Apartments | $1,278 | $695 | $1,653 |
Golden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,610 | $998 | $3,061 |
Golden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,993 | $1,175 | $2,999 |
Golden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,299 | $1,500 | $2,698 |
Golden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,665 | $2,595 | $2,700 |
